Pasta with apple and pepper sauce

Spread the love

Ingredients for 2 servings:

  • 250 g pasta, preferably fusilli
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 onion(s)
  • 2 cloves garlic
  • 1 chili pepper(s)
  • 50 g bacon, as desired
  • 1 apple
  • 1 red bell pepper(s)
  • 1 shot of white wine
  • 1 cup vegetable broth
  • 1 tbsp herb cream cheese
  • salt and pepper

Instructions

Working time approx. 15 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 15 minutes; Total time approx. 30 minutes

Add the pasta to boiling salted water and cook according to the instructions until al dente. Meanwhile, finely chop or dice the onion, garlic, chili pepper, and bacon. Fry the onion in olive oil, then the garlic, chili pepper, and bacon. Quarter the apple (with the skin on, if you like), then halve the quarters crosswise and cut into thin slices. Cut the bell pepper into thin strips. Add both to the pan and fry for a few minutes. Deglaze with a splash of white wine and the vegetable stock, stir in the cream cheese, and simmer for a few more minutes. Mix with the pasta and season with salt and pepper.
